 Honors Program

Effective with the class of 2027

Class of 2023,24,25,26 will follow previous guidelines mentioned in the Course Guide Book

 

At the end of the last semester of their senior year, only those students who have completed all graduation requirements may participate in the graduation ceremony. To graduate with honors, a student must earn 25 units of credit, graduate with at least a 3.5 GPA (weighted) and complete guidelines listed below. One unit of credit is earned for passing a course that meets for two semesters. Successful completion of a course that meets for only one semester earns one-half unit of credit. Specific requirements are listed below:

Cum Laude Honors System
Cum Laude Magna Cum Laude Summa Cum Laude
*3.7-3.99 Cumulative GPA *4.0-4.19 Cumulative GPA *4.2-Above Cumulative GPA
*6 Honors Credits *9 Honors Credits *12 Honors Credits
*4 Credits Language Arts *4 Credits Language Arts *4 Credits Language Arts
*4 Credits Science *4 Credits Science *4 Credits Science
*4 Credits Math *4 Credits Math *4 Credits Math
*4 Credits Social Studies *4 Credits Social Studies *4 Credits Social Studies
*2 Foreign Language *2 Foreign Language *2 Foreign Language
*2/4 EOC's Proficient/Advanced or 20+ on ACT *3/4 EOC's Proficient/Advanced or 22+ on ACT *4/4 EOC's Proficient/Advanced or 24+ on ACT
 
* In order for a student to be placed into core honors classes, the student must have a miminum of 85% in the class.
* In order for a student to remain in the core honors class, the student must obtain a minimum 80% or have a teacher reccomendation.
* If a student cannot maintain the requirments after being inside of the core honors class, they will not be allowed to join in following years.
*Written appeal for testing requirements may be made

 

 

*Graduating with Honors and participating in the Honors Progam is different than the National Honors Society (NHS)
